3. Setup Guide

3.1 Connecting to Xbox Console

  1. Ensure your Xbox console (Series X|S or One X|S) is powered on.
  2. Connect the USB-C end of the provided cable to the port on the top of the GameSir G7 SE controller.
  3. Connect the USB-A end of the cable to an available USB port on your Xbox console.
  4. The controller will automatically be recognized by the console and is ready for use.

3.2 Connecting to Windows PC

  1. Ensure your Windows 10/11 PC is powered on.
  2. Connect the USB-C end of the provided cable to the port on the top of the GameSir G7 SE controller.
  3. Connect the USB-A end of the cable to an available USB port on your PC.
  4. The PC will automatically detect and install the necessary drivers. This may take a few moments.
  5. Once drivers are installed, the controller is ready for use with compatible games and applications.

4. Operating Instructions

4.1 Basic Controls

The GameSir G7 SE controller features standard Xbox button layouts, including A, B, X, Y buttons, D-pad, left and right analog sticks, shoulder buttons (LB, RB), and triggers (LT, RT). The Xbox button in the center provides access to the Xbox Guide or Windows Game Bar.

4.2 Hall Effect Joysticks and Triggers

The Hall Effect technology in the joysticks and triggers provides magnetic sensing for input, reducing wear and tear and offering precise, drift-free control with an accuracy of up to 0.1mm. This ensures long-term reliability and consistent performance.

4.4 Switching Profiles

The controller supports quickly switching between up to 4 custom profiles (Default, Profile 1, Profile 2, Profile 3). Use the 'M' button in combination with the A, B, X, or Y buttons to cycle through your saved profiles.
